MG Road to Kadugodi Tree Park by Namma Metro

The metro journey from MG Road to Kadugodi Tree Park runs on the Purple Line. It covers 18.4 km and 16 stops, taking about 40m end to end — roughly 28 km/h once station stops are counted. A token costs 70, or about ₹63–₹66.50 with a Namma Metro smart card.

Board at MG Road on Platform 1, on the side signposted towards Whitefield (Kadugodi) — that is the direction of travel, not your destination. There is no change of train on this route. First train is around 5:00 AM on weekdays and 7:00 AM on Sundays, with the last around 11:05 PM.

Monday mornings the Purple Line starts earlier than the rest of the week to clear the backlog from Sunday night track maintenance. Allow a few extra minutes at MG Road for security screening, which is mandatory at every Namma Metro entrance.

MG RoadKadugodi Tree Park — Common Questions

How long does the metro take from MG Road to Kadugodi Tree Park?

About 40m in normal running, covering 18.4 km and 16 stops — an average of roughly 28 km/h including station dwell time.

What is the metro fare from MG Road to Kadugodi Tree Park?

A single-journey token costs ₹70 at the current BMRCL tariff. Paying with a Namma Metro smart card brings it down to about ₹63–₹66.50, since the card discount is 10% off-peak and 5% during weekday peak hours. Children under 3 ft travel free.

Is there a direct metro from MG Road to Kadugodi Tree Park?

Yes. MG Road and Kadugodi Tree Park are both on the Purple Line, so it is a direct ride with no change of train. Board on Platform 1 towards Whitefield (Kadugodi).

What time is the first and last metro from MG Road?

On this route the first train is around 5:00 AM Monday to Saturday and 7:00 AM on Sunday, with the last train at about 11:05 PM. Trains run every 3–5 min in peak hours. Times are BMRCL scheduled service — allow a few minutes for security screening at the entrance.
